Details
-
Bug
-
Resolution: Fixed
-
Low
-
1.10.0
-
None
Description
Steps to reproduce
- Setup JIRA 6.3.4a
- install JIRA Portfolio
Expected result
JIRA Portfolio will get installed, enabled, and work fine
Actual result
JIRA Portfolio will get installed and enabled (in manage add-ons page), but there will be no Portfolio menu on the top bar
The stack trace in the log
2015-07-06 15:20:02,644 UpmAsynchronousTaskManager:thread-3 INFO admin 919x301x2 142ytn4 10.60.5.118 /rest/plugins/1.0/ [atlassian.plugin.manager.PluginEnabler] Waiting for ENABLING plugins: [com.radiantminds.roadmaps-jira] 2015-07-06 15:20:02,644 UpmAsynchronousTaskManager:thread-3 INFO admin 919x301x2 142ytn4 10.60.5.118 /rest/plugins/1.0/ [atlassian.plugin.util.WaitUntil] Plugins that have yet to be enabled: [com.radiantminds.roadmaps-jira], 60 seconds remaining 2015-07-06 15:20:03,644 UpmAsynchronousTaskManager:thread-3 INFO admin 919x301x2 142ytn4 10.60.5.118 /rest/plugins/1.0/ [atlassian.plugin.util.WaitUntil] Plugins that have yet to be enabled: [com.radiantminds.roadmaps-jira], 59 seconds remaining 2015-07-06 15:20:04,644 UpmAsynchronousTaskManager:thread-3 INFO admin 919x301x2 142ytn4 10.60.5.118 /rest/plugins/1.0/ [atlassian.plugin.manager.PluginEnabler] Plugin 'com.radiantminds.roadmaps-jira' is now ENABLED 2015-07-06 15:21:28,225 http-bio-8634-exec-16 WARN admin 921x368x1 142ytn4 10.60.5.118 /plugins/servlet/upm [plugins.jira.conditions.PluginAdminAccessCondition] For input string: "4a" java.lang.NumberFormatException: For input string: "4a" at java.lang.NumberFormatException.forInputString(NumberFormatException.java:65) at java.lang.Integer.parseInt(Integer.java:492) at java.lang.Integer.parseInt(Integer.java:527) at org.osgi.framework.Version.<init>(Version.java:133) at com.atlassian.jpo.apis.Version.<init>(Version.java:11) at com.atlassian.jpo.jira.api.JiraVersionAccessor.getVersion(JiraVersionAccessor.java:27) at com.atlassian.jpo.apis.VersionAwareSpringProxyInvocationHandler.invoke(VersionAwareSpringProxyInvocationHandler.java:30) at com.sun.proxy.$Proxy6484.getGroupsForUser(Unknown Source) at com.radiantminds.roadmap.jira.common.components.extension.users.JiraUserExtension.getActiveUserData(JiraUserExtension.java:75) at com.radiantminds.roadmap.common.permissions.PluginPermissions.check(PluginPermissions.java:52) at com.radiantminds.roadmap.common.permissions.PluginPermissions.check(PluginPermissions.java:73) at com.radiantminds.plugins.jira.conditions.PluginAdminAccessCondition.shouldDisplay(PluginAdminAccessCondition.java:32) at com.atlassian.plugin.web.DefaultWebInterfaceManager.filterFragmentsByCondition(DefaultWebInterfaceManager.java:153) at com.atlassian.plugin.web.DefaultWebInterfaceManager.getDisplayableItems(DefaultWebInterfaceManager.java:106) at com.atlassian.plugin.web.DefaultWebInterfaceManager.getDisplayableWebItems(DefaultWebInterfaceManager.java:214) at com.atlassian.jira.plugin.webfragment.DefaultSimpleLinkManager.getLinksForSection(DefaultSimpleLinkManager.java:131) at com.atlassian.jira.plugin.webfragment.DefaultSimpleLinkManager.getLinksForSection(DefaultSimpleLinkManager.java:124) at com.atlassian.jira.web.sitemesh.AdminDecoratorHelper.getLinksForSection(AdminDecoratorHelper.java:583) at com.atlassian.jira.web.sitemesh.AdminDecoratorHelper.getSectionContainsAtleastOneLink(AdminDecoratorHelper.java:601) at com.atlassian.jira.web.sitemesh.AdminDecoratorHelper.makeSideMenuSoyRenderData(AdminDecoratorHelper.java:369) at com.atlassian.jira.web.sitemesh.AdminDecoratorHelper.makeChildSectionsForSection(AdminDecoratorHelper.java:391) at com.atlassian.jira.web.sitemesh.AdminDecoratorHelper.makeSideMenuSoyRenderData(AdminDecoratorHelper.java:380) at com.atlassian.jira.web.sitemesh.AdminDecoratorHelper.makeChildSectionsForSection(AdminDecoratorHelper.java:391) at com.atlassian.jira.web.sitemesh.AdminDecoratorHelper.makeSideMenuSoyRenderData(AdminDecoratorHelper.java:380) at com.atlassian.jira.web.sitemesh.AdminDecoratorHelper.setCurrentTab(AdminDecoratorHelper.java:115) at org.apache.jsp.decorators.admin_jsp._jspService(admin_jsp.java:191) at org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:70) at javax.servlet.http.HttpServlet.service(HttpServlet.java:727) at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:432) at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:390) at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:334) at javax.servlet.http.HttpServlet.service(HttpServlet.java:727) <+36> (ApplicationFilterChain.java:303) (ApplicationFilterChain.java:208) (IteratingFilterChain.java:46)